Samuel MORLAND
Adm. sizar (age 18) at MAGDALENE, May, 1645.
S. of Thomas, R. of Sulhampstead, Berkshire . B. there.
School, Winchester [ Hampshire ].
Matric. 1645 ;
B.A. 1648/9 ;
M.A. 1652 .
Fellow, 1649 .
At first a parliamentarian.
Secretary to Thurloe, 1654 ; employed on missions abroad.
Joined King Charles at Breda [ Holland ], 1660 .
Knighted, 20 May, 1660.
Created Bart., 18 Jul., 1660.
Gentleman of the Privy Chamber, 1660-81 .
Commissioner of Appeals in Excise, 1668-70 .
Commissioner of Excise, 1670-9 .
Ingenious mechanical inventor; made important discoveries in connection with hydrostatics.
Author, mathematical, etc.
Became blind, 1692 .
Died 26 Dec., 1695; buried at Hammersmith [ London ].
Will (P.C.C.) 1696 .
Father of the next.
( D.N.B.; G.E.C. ; A. B. Beaven.)
